Quoting Jason Gunthorpe (2019-06-13 16:26:13)
> On Thu, Jun 13, 2019 at 11:09:24AM -0700, Stephen Boyd wrote:
> > From: Andrey Pronin <apronin@chromium.org>
> >
> > Other drivers or userspace may initiate sending a message to the tpm
> > while the device itself and the controller of the bus it is on are
> > suspended. That may break the bus driver logic.
> > Block sending messages while the device is suspended.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Andrey Pronin <apronin@chromium.org>
> > Signed-off-by: Stephen Boyd <swboyd@chromium.org>
> >
> > I don't think this was ever posted before.
>
> Use a real lock.
>

To make sure the bit is tested under a lock so that suspend/resume can't
update the bit in parallel?
